CA 2363316

The invention relates to a process for filling a mixture of at least two monomeric and/or oligomeric components into a container (12), which mixture, after discharge from the container (12), polymerizes with at least partial volume increase, comprising a mixing zone (13) to which the at least two components to be mixed are fed, the at least two components being mixed under pressure in the mixing zone (13) and the mixture under pressure being filled into the container (12).
